Career Role (Fishery Data Collection) Description
Fisheries Scientist Collects and analyzes data on fish stocks, habitats, and ecosystems; crucial for sustainable fisheries management.
Data Analyst (Fisheries) Processes and interprets complex fishery data, identifies trends, and develops reports for resource management. Requires strong analytical and statistical skills.
Fisheries Observer Collects data at sea on fishing operations, species caught, and bycatch. Essential for stock assessment and regulation.
Marine Data Technician Supports data collection processes, ensures data quality and accuracy, and assists with data management systems.
